LIVELY, Circuit Judge.

This contract action for recovery of medical expenses incurred by a decedent was removed to federal district court as one arising under the Employee Retirement Income Security Act of 1974, 29 U.S.C. § 1001 et seq. (1988) (ERISA) and the Medicare Secondary Payer statute, 42 U.S.C. § 1395y (1988 & Supp. V 1993) (MSP).
